A certified lab report can look like a wall of abbreviations. It is actually answering three simple questions for each thing tested: how much did we find, how much is considered acceptable, and did we find any at all.
The units
Most results come back in milligrams per liter (mg/L), which is the same as parts per million. Trace contaminants use micrograms per liter (µg/L), parts per billion. Hardness often shows up in grains per gallon (gpg) on treatment quotes, though labs usually report it as mg/L of calcium carbonate.
The unit matters more than the number. A 5 in mg/L and a 5 in µg/L differ by a factor of a thousand.
The limits
For regulated contaminants, EPA publishes maximum contaminant levels (MCLs): the enforceable ceilings public utilities must meet. Private wells are not held to them by anyone, which is exactly why they are the right yardstick to read your own results against.
Some entries carry a secondary standard instead. Those cover taste, odor, and staining rather than health, which is worth knowing before you react to a number.
What ND means
ND is not detected: the lab looked and found nothing above its reporting limit. It is the result you want to see, and on most lines, it is the result most homes get.
